Common Situations That Lead to Truck Towing Requests

Several circumstances may leave a commercial vehicle unable to continue operating safely. Engine failures, transmission problems, brake system issues, driveline damage, and collision-related incidents frequently require professional assistance.

Attempting to operate a compromised truck can increase safety concerns while potentially causing further mechanical damage. Professional recovery services help transport vehicles safely to repair facilities or designated locations.

Understanding these situations helps operators make informed decisions during roadside emergencies.

Early Warning Signs of Potential Truck Problems

  • Frequent engine overheating.
  • Air brake performance concerns.
  • Transmission shifting irregularities.
  • Excessive tire wear patterns.
  • Unusual vibration during operation.

Addressing these warning signs early may help reduce the likelihood of unexpected breakdowns.

Best Practices During Roadside Emergencies

  • Activate emergency warning devices immediately.
  • Move the vehicle to a safe location when possible.
  • Remain aware of surrounding traffic.
  • Communicate accurate location details.
  • Follow established safety procedures.

These steps help improve safety while awaiting professional assistance.

Additional Recommendations for Fleet Operators

Routine inspections remain one of the most effective ways to reduce unexpected roadside incidents. Regular maintenance of tires, braking systems, electrical components, and driveline assemblies can help identify issues before they become serious problems.

Fleet managers should also maintain emergency response procedures and keep recovery contact information accessible to drivers. Preparation often improves response times and minimizes operational disruptions.

Preventive planning plays an important role in long-term vehicle reliability.
